Scott... hopefully Chuck will jump in on this one but I can give you some background on a few clients that I've worked with where the account has grown dramatically:

1. First, my experience is that these type of accounts have tend to be more corporate and less small biz. As Chuck said, its the guys that already know that they have to spend money to make money. 2. In my experience they already have a fairly large marketing budget that they can allocate or reallocate in the way that they see fit. 2 times we ramped fast with a client they had big TV budgets where they shifted dollars to online initiatives. The other one was a big B2B software company that had essentially laid off a multi-million dollar sales force to completely revamp sales/marketing (again a big pool of money). 3. This one is critical.... you have to be willing to ask for it. That was one of Chuck's points. He never got scared or said let's go slow. We had a client who said how can I "own" his category. I brought him the proposal and he about had a heart attack it was an honest assessment of what he needed. He ended up going with the proposal.
